2nd Shift – CNC Machinist 

Nashua, NH
Monday-Friday | 3:00 PM-11:00 PM
$26.00-$35.00 an hour

Masis Staffing Solutions is assisting our client in searching for an experienced CNC Machinist to join their growing team in Nashua, NH. This is a great opportunity for a skilled machinist who enjoys working in a fast-paced prototype manufacturing environment and has experience with CNC setup, operation, and programming.

Responsibilities:

  • Set up and operate CNC milling and/or lathe machines.
  • Create and modify programs using Mastercam and CAD/CAM software.
  • Interpret blueprints, drawings, and specifications to manufacture precision parts.
  • Inspect finished parts using precision measuring instruments to ensure quality standards are met.
  • Perform machine maintenance, operator PMs, and maintain an organized work area.
  • Troubleshoot machining and production issues as needed.
  • Ensure jobs are completed accurately and on schedule.
  • Follow all safety, quality, and housekeeping standards.

Qualifications:

  • High School Diploma or GED required.
  • Previous CNC machining experience required, including machine setup and operation.
  • Experience with Mastercam, SolidWorks, and CAD/CAM software preferred.
  • Ability to read blueprints and understand geometric tolerances.
  • Experience using measuring tools such as calipers, height gauges, and protractors.
  • Strong mechanical aptitude and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ent attention to detail and organizational skills.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
